My truck seems to be draining the battery over night. This has happened in the past and turned out the glow plug relay kicked the bucket. We replaced the relay last year. Now the truck is having the battery drain again but I am not sure if this is the cause again. Is there any way to check the relay? Is there any common problems that drain the batteries other than the glow plug relay on these trucks?

 

Any help MUCH appreciated as I rely on this truck for work.

 

The truck is a 2002 GMC Sierra, 6.6L Diesel (dually)

 

As a side note, there is no check engine light and my OBD2 reader is not picking any codes up.
